obitod
TUYA5 cyberrealistic_v40 Doodle Art 涂鸦国
Size: 1920 x 1080
AI Model: Doodle Art 涂鸦国
Created date: December 11, 2023, 11:14 PM
Picture ID: 65b95e78f7254048911d1d4f